Our client, a leading full-service financial institution in Nigeria, is looking for suitably qualified candidates to head its Foundation, which is a not-for-profit entity established to operationalize our client's corporate social responsibility strategies and initiatives.
Details:
• The ideal candidate will report to the Board of Directors and will have strategic oversight of the Foundation's operations and programmes along its defined focus areas.
• The ideal candidate will also champion the development and maintenance of the desired corporate culture, values and reputation with all stakeholders; establish and maintain key relationships with relevant parties for collaboration and impact; and be responsible for overall strategic planning, fund sourcing, financial management, organizational development, staff management and program operations management.
• S/he will work collaboratively with the Board of Directors in leading the transformation of the Foundation to a mature state, to facilitate achievement of strategic objectives.
Key Responsibilities:
• Participate (alongside the Board) in the articulation and/or modification of the Foundation's corporate social responsibility (CSR) strategy.
• Champion the development of the strategic plans for the Foundation and ensure linkage with overall organisational strategy.
• Ensure that the Foundation's strategy is properly cascaded across all levels within the Foundation.
• Cultivate a strong partnership with the Board of Directors in setting policies consistent with the mission of the Foundation, as needed, with all standing and ad hoc committees of the Board.
• Oversee and support the development, design and delivery of program initiatives, ensuring that the goals and objectives are aligned with the Foundation's overall strategic plan.
• Oversee preparation of the annual budget and other necessary financial documents and provide information and justifications for Board of Directors in its budgetary review and approval process.
• Promote the Foundation's visibility and welfare through participation and membership in community forums, civic organizations and activities that are aligned with the Foundation's mission and vision.
• Interpret and communicate the goals, milestones and achievements of the Foundation to potential donors, the business community, the media, and the public, exploring traditional communication channels and online media.
• Maintain constant communication with relevant officers within the mother institution to explore avenues for the Foundation's positive brand affinity to impact on the Group's reputational capital.
• Actively seek and maintain a diverse donor base of individuals, businesses, government and other relevant agencies and entities.
• Manage all fund-sourcing activities, including grant writing, as well as stewardship of existing donors, identification of new sources, and event planning.
• Oversee the Foundation's fund-raising activities; ensuring that acceptance of donations does not pose conflicts of interest to the Foundation.
• Oversee the sourcing, evaluation and selection of relevant partner organizations in line with the Foundation's focus areas.
• Champion the management of relationships with all stakeholders.
• Provide direction to Portfolio Managers in the coordination and control of projects/programs along the Foundation's focus areas.
• Review and authorize programme proposals and requests.
• Ensure effective monitoring of budget and time performance of various projects.
• Ensure authorization of the Foundations financial expenditure/transactions in line with approved authority limits.
• Serve as an interface between the Board and employees of the Foundation.
• Present progress reports on deliverables of the Foundation's corporate social investment programs to the Board and other stakeholders.
• Champion the periodic review of the Foundation's processes to identify improvement opportunities.
• Work creatively and innovatively to quickly establish the Foundation as a leading not-for-profit organization within the scope of its identified focus areas.
• Oversee all activities of the Foundation and ensure compliance with internal policies and government regulations.
